Population Overview
Lebanon city is a small community located in Kansas. The total population is 188. It ranks as the 442nd most populous out of 726 cities and towns in Kansas.
Age Demographics
The median age in Lebanon city is 52.8 years. This is 42% higher than the state median of 37.2 years. 12.2% of residents are 75 or older, suggesting a significant retirement-age population with implications for healthcare services and senior housing.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in Lebanon city is $38,125. This is 48% lower than the state median of $72,639.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 51% lower. The poverty rate stands at 7.4%. This is 35% lower than the state poverty rate of 11.5%. The unemployment rate is 0.0%. This is 100% lower than the state rate of 3.9%. The median home value is $36,300. Housing costs are 82% lower than the state median of $203,400.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 1.0x, Lebanon city is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 90.1%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 35% higher than the state average of 66.9%.
Race & Ethnicity
Lebanon city has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 93.1% of all residents.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 0.5%. The Hispanic or Latino population (0.5%) is well below the state average of 13.3%.
Education
18.4%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 48% lower than the state rate of 35.2%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 93.2%.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for Lebanon city, Kansas is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Kansas state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 726 Census-designated places in Kansas.
